Eagle Beach is a beach and neighbourhood of Oranjestad, Aruba. The neighbourhood is famous for its many low-rise resorts and wide public beach. It is the widest beach of Aruba. and has soft white sand. It has been rated one of the best beaches in the world. Eagle Beach is situated 1½ km north of Divi Dutch Village Beach Resort.

The National Archaeological Museum Aruba is an archaeological museum in the city of Oranjestad in Aruba. The collections cover from 2500 BCE to the 19th century. National Archaeological Museum Aruba is situated 2 km southeast of Divi Dutch Village Beach Resort.

Fort Zoutman is a military fortification at Oranjestad, Aruba. Originally built in 1798 by African slaves, with materials provided by the Amerindians, who performed Statute Labour or corvée for the Dutch West India Company, it is the oldest structure on the… Fort Zoutman is situated 2½ km southeast of Divi Dutch Village Beach Resort.

Rancho, located near Paardenbaai, is one of the old districts of Oranjestad, the capital of Aruba. Originally a fishing village, Rancho has evolved into a neighbourhood of Oranjestad.

Oranjestad is the capital and largest city of Aruba. The city is home to some of the island's local residents and also many governmental buildings. Along the main "drag" you will find mostly tourist walking around and shopping and can also see the cruise ships that bring more and more external tourism into the island everyday.

Tanki Leendert is a town in Noord on the island of Aruba. The parish of Tanki Leendert has been split from Noord since 1968. Tanki Leendert is situated 4 km east of Divi Dutch Village Beach Resort.
